Early Life and Education

Rosa Brooks was born on April 13, 1967, in Los Angeles, California. She grew up in a politically active family, with her father being the well-known journalist and author, Barbara Ehrenreich. Brooks attended Harvard University, where she earned a Bachelor of Arts degree in history. She later went on to earn a law degree from Yale Law School.

Government Service

After completing her education, Brooks served as a law clerk for Judge Harry T. Edwards on the U.S. Court of Appeals for the D.C. Circuit. She then worked as a trial attorney for the U.S. Department of Justice before joining the Office of the Legal Adviser at the U.S. Department of State. Brooks also served as a senior advisor at the U.S. Department of Defense, where she focused on issues related to human rights and the rule of law.

Writing Career

Rosa Brooks is also a prolific writer, with her work appearing in publications such as The New York Times, The Washington Post, and Foreign Policy. She is the author of several books, including "How Everything Became War and the Military Became Everything" and "Tangled Up in Blue: Policing the American City."
